Hadith 28:515

Yahya ibn Abi Bukayr narrated to us, Shu'bah narrated to us, from Qatadah, who said: I heard Abu Ayyub al-Azdi narrating from Abdullah ibn Amr, who said—he did not attribute it to the Prophet twice, then I asked him a third time, and he said—the Messenger of Allah (peace and blessings of Allah be upon him) said: "The time for the Dhuhr prayer is as long as the Asr has not arrived. The time for the Asr prayer is as long as the sun has not turned yellow. The time for the Maghrib prayer is as long as the light of the twilight has not fallen. The time for the Isha prayer is until the middle of the night. And the time for the Fajr prayer is as long as the sun has not risen."

حدثنا يحيى بن أبي بكير، حدثنا شعبة، عن قتادة، سمعت أبا أيوب الأزدي، يحدث، عن عبد الله بن عمرو، قال: - لم يرفعه مرتين، قال: وسألته الثالثة، فقال - قال رسول الله صلى الله عليه وسلم: " وقت صلاة الظهر، ما لم يحضر العصر، ووقت صلاة العصر، ما لم تصفر الشمس، ووقت صلاة المغرب، ما لم يسقط نور الشفق، ووقت صلاة العشاء إلى نصف الليل، ووقت صلاة الفجر ما لم تطلع الشمس "
